Once Upon a Katamari Announced, Out on October 24

The newest entry in the Katamari franchise will also include a new soundtrack, as well as online multiplayer for up to four players.

A new game in the Katamari franchise has been announced during the recent Nintendo Direct: Partner Showcase. Titled Once Upon a Katamari, the game was announced alongside a trailer which you can check out below.

The trailer gives us a good glimpse at the kind of insanity that players can expect from Once Upon a Katamari, complete with its classic-styled gameplay that involves rolling up all objects in a level in order to re-populate the stars in the sky after the King of the Cosmos ended up destroying them once again. Gameplay will be quite similar to previous Katamari games, making use of both analogue sticks with a unique control scheme.

Once Upon a Katamari will also feature 69 cousins that players can take control of, as well as a multiplayer mode with support for up to four players online. The game also features new songs as part of its soundtrack that players will get to enjoy throughout their time with it.

Once Upon a Katamari is out on October 24, and while only a Nintendo Switch version has been currently confirmed, it might also eventually make its way to other platforms.
